Location: Northern Alberta (Remote Camp – 14/7 or 21/7 rotation)

Project Type: Earthworks & Civil Construction (Oil Sands SAGD Pad & Access Roads)

About the Role

We are seeking a proactive, knowledgeable, and safety-focused Onsite HSE Advisor to join our team for a large-scale civil earthworks project in Northern Alberta. Working on a remote rotational schedule, you will be the primary health, safety, and environment representative onsite, supporting both field crews and management to ensure safe, compliant, and efficient operations.

Key Responsibilities

- Lead and support all site HSE initiatives in compliance with company policy, client requirements, and Alberta OHS legislation.
- Conduct and document daily toolbox talks, hazard assessments (FLHA/JHA), and regular site inspections.
- Ensure all safety supplies and emergency response equipment are onsite, functional, and compliant.
- Provide coaching, mentorship, and guidance to field supervisors and workers on safe work practices.
- Support the Onsite Superintendent as directed, and provide the Project Manager with any requested HSE data or documentation.
- Monitor and enforce PPE compliance and safe work procedures.
- Lead or assist in incident reporting, investigation, and corrective action tracking.
- Ensure training and competency records are complete and current.
- Monitor environmental controls (fuel handling, erosion control, spill prevention) and report any non-compliances.
- Act as a liaison with the client’s HSE team and participate in daily coordination meetings.

Qualifications

- Minimum 3–5 years’ experience in construction or earthworks safety (oil sands experience preferred).
- Strong knowledge of Alberta OHS Act, Regulation, and Code.
- Valid safety certifications such as CSTS, WHMIS, First Aid, Ground Disturbance, and Wildlife Awareness.
- Valid Class 5 driver’s license and clean abstract.
- Previous experience in remote camp settings an asset.
- Strong communication, conflict resolution, and leadership skills.
- Ability to work in all weather conditions and adapt to changing project priorities.

Schedule & Compensation

- Rotation: 14 days on / 7 days off or 21 days on / 7 days off (depending on project schedule)
- Remote camp accommodations and meals provided
- Competitive hourly wage plus overtime
- Travel allowance or flights provided from designated hubs
